Recognition of Foreign Licenses
Foreign licenses might be legitimate in Switzerland for a restricted duration, but they need to be transformed into a Swiss license if you are a resident. Each canton has its own policies concerning the conversion process, which can often be dealt with online.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. The length of time does it take to get a Swiss motorist's license?
- The entire process can take anywhere from a few weeks to several months, depending on private situations and the efficiency of the cantonal workplace.
2. Is it possible to drive instantly after passing the theory test?
- No, passing the theory test allows you to take useful driving lessons. Mehr erfahren can not drive legally until you have passed both tests and received your chauffeur's license.
3. Can I utilize my foreign chauffeur's license in Switzerland?
- Yes, however foreign licenses are normally legitimate for just 12 months, after which you need to convert to a Swiss license.
4. Are there additional charges beyond the application fee?
- Yes, additional costs may include charges for driving lessons, theory and useful tests, and file translations.
5. Can I book my theory and useful tests online?
- Yes, a lot of cantonal offices offer online reservation for both theory and useful tests.
